  • Weka

    Weka

    Arthur's Pass, South Island. This native flightless rail is found on both the North and South Islands, but is much more common on the South Island. It is quite large, at 53 cm in length and about 1 kg in weight for males.

  • Takahe

    Takahe

    Tiritiri Matangi Island. The Takahe is a large flightless member of the rail family weighing up to 3 kg. Mainly vegetarian, these birds once grazed by the thousands in New Zealand grasslands. Thought to have become extinct in 1898, a few were re-discovered in the Murchison Mountains, South Island in 1948. A captive breeding program and translocation of some birds to predator-free islands has brought the population to about 263 birds as of 2013 .

  • Keas, juveniles

    Keas, juveniles

    The Kea is a large (1 kg for males) parrot which lives mainly in the alpine zone of the South Island. Keas are bold and noisy birds; the yellow cere and eye-ring of these two birds indicate they are juveniles. Arthur's Pass, South Island.
